Ordinals
beta
Sat 902947029304835
decimal
180589.2029304835
degree
0°180589′1165″2029304835‴
percentile
42.99747763324177%
name
hllfyzygxxu
cycle
0
epoch
0
period
89
block
180589
offset
2029304835
timestamp
2012-05-18 06:08:20 UTC
rarity
common
prev
next